Gionkoh Hotel - Kyoto
34.99995849, 135.7788733The 2-star Gionkoh Hotel Kyoto, a mere 200 metres from Yasaka Shrine features a courtyard and various recreational opportunities. Located within walking distance of such shopping venues as Miyakomesse Convention Center, this Kyoto guest house has 10 rooms just a short stroll from a bus stop.
Location
Situated in the heart of Kyoto, the property gives quick access to Hanamikoji Dori, which stands only a 5-minute walk away. The area includes such religious sights as the Zen Temple of the Silver Pavilion (3.4 km) and Sanjusangendo Temple (1.9 km). Visit Rokuya-on Garden, only 650 metres from the hotel, and feel complete harmony with the nature of Japan. Gionkoh Hotel is located only a few minutes from Kodai-ji Buddhist Temple and offers views of the city.
For those travelling from afar, Itami airport is 52 minutes' drive away.

The traditional layout and ambiance provided a genuinely authentic experience, complete with that charming garden view perfect for a morning coffee. The futons offered surprising comfort, ensuring a good night's rest after a long day of exploration.
Be prepared to haul your luggage up a steep flight of stairs, which can be a pain if you're loaded down. The building lacks good winter insulation, so bring something warm for sitting by the garden in colder months. Keep in mind that noise travels easily, especially footsteps from above, which could be bothersome to light sleepers.
